Transaction 0856028ed2c5792331c7184182912c5f3ea3158de396a55402f8319b8d6ee491

1 Input
2 Outputs
  • 0856028ed2c5792331c7184182912c5f3ea3158de396a55402f8319b8d6ee491:0
  • value  9825542
    address  3AmDHpbeoEdbUj2FTvwk61UjLvBvxfVD6U
  • 0856028ed2c5792331c7184182912c5f3ea3158de396a55402f8319b8d6ee491:1
  • value  21232586
    address  3Eo3BKCQVGTsdo3YBzg2ktRhAWVEtBgtHc